UNVEILING THE DIVINE NATURE OF SEXUAL PLEASURE: EXPLORING RELIGIOUS PERSPECTIVES ON INTIMACY

3 min read Theology

Religion has always been an integral part of human life, shaping belief systems and guiding ethics throughout history. Sexual experience is also a fundamental aspect of the human condition, encompassing physical, emotional, and spiritual dimensions. This paper seeks to explore how sexual experiences can be interpreted as potential sources of divine insight within various religions, examining the frameworks provided by religious teachings to support such views.

The concept of sexual pleasure as a medium for divine revelation can be traced back to ancient texts from many different faith traditions. In Hinduism, for example, the Kama Sutra describes ways in which couples can attain spiritual awakening through intimate encounters, viewing them as opportunities for self-transcendence and communion with the Divine. Similarly, Tantric practices promote the idea that sex can serve as a pathway to enlightenment, leading practitioners to transcend their egos and connect with higher levels of consciousness. The Quran also acknowledges the power of erotic love, describing it as a gift from God that should be enjoyed responsibly and chastely.

Within Christianity, the Song of Songs offers a similar perspective, depicting sexual desire as a manifestation of divine love between two partners. The Catholic Church, however, has historically viewed sexuality as a temptation to be suppressed or controlled, emphasizing celibacy and abstinence over physical fulfillment.

Some contemporary theologians argue that this approach distorts the original intent of biblical teachings, suggesting instead that sex is a sacred expression of the creative power of God and an important aspect of human flourishing.

In Jewish tradition, Kabbalah stresses the importance of balancing sexual energy with other forms of spiritual practice, seeing both as necessary for achieving harmony and wholeness. This approach highlights the inherent interconnectedness of all aspects of life and encourages individuals to embrace their sexual desires as part of a broader spiritual journey.

Buddhism offers a more nuanced perspective on sexual experience, recognizing its potential for pleasure but cautioning against attachment and craving. According to Buddhist teaching, true liberation comes when one lets go of ego-driven attachments and desires, including those related to sex. Nevertheless, some Buddhists see sensual pleasures as a way to achieve greater awareness and understanding, emphasizing the need for mindful engagement in all facets of life.

These various approaches suggest that sexual experiences can provide unique opportunities for individuals to connect with the divine, whether through erotic ecstasy, transcendent union, or mindful surrender. By embracing sexuality as a natural and integral part of being human, we can deepen our understanding of ourselves and the world around us, ultimately leading to greater spiritual growth and enlightenment.
